- Testosterone Replacement Therapy (TRT) ∞ The male hormonal framework is built around testosterone. It governs muscle mass, bone density, cognitive drive, and metabolic health. As natural production declines, typically about 1% per year after age 30 or 40, introducing bioidentical testosterone recalibrates the entire system. This protocol restores the chemical messenger responsible for maintaining a masculine physiological blueprint, leading to direct improvements in energy, lean body mass, and mental clarity. Studies have shown that TRT can significantly improve muscle strength, particularly in men with lower baseline levels.
- Hormone Replacement Therapy (HRT) for Women ∞ For women, the menopausal transition represents a significant shift in the hormonal landscape, primarily a rapid decline in estrogen. This change impacts everything from bone density and cardiovascular health to cognitive function and skin elasticity. HRT provides the necessary estrogen to maintain the stability of these systems. Recent research indicates that when initiated within a specific window, typically within six years of menopause, HRT can have protective effects on both heart and brain health.
- Peptide Therapy ∞ Peptides are small chains of amino acids that act as highly specific signaling molecules. They are the specialists of cellular communication, delivering precise instructions to targeted cells. Unlike broad hormonal signals, peptides can be used to initiate very specific actions, such as stimulating the pituitary gland’s own production of growth hormone or accelerating tissue repair.
One of the most effective peptides in this domain is Sermorelin. It functions as a growth hormone-releasing hormone (GHRH) analog, which means it signals the pituitary gland to produce and release your body’s own natural growth hormone Meaning ∞ Growth hormone, or somatotropin, is a peptide hormone synthesized by the anterior pituitary gland, essential for stimulating cellular reproduction, regeneration, and somatic growth. (GH). This is a crucial distinction from direct GH administration.
Sermorelin preserves the body’s natural feedback loops, promoting a physiological, pulsatile release of GH that aligns with your innate biological rhythms. This approach enhances recovery, improves sleep quality, and supports metabolic function without overriding the body’s regulatory safeguards.

- Deep System Analysis ∞ The process starts with a comprehensive diagnostic panel. This goes far beyond standard blood work. We measure a wide array of biomarkers, including free and total testosterone, estradiol, IGF-1 (a proxy for growth hormone), and a full metabolic and thyroid panel. This data creates a detailed map of your current endocrine state, identifying the specific areas where communication has become inefficient.
